Job Description:
The Staffing Specialist is responsible for collaborating with management and employees in the areas of recruiting and new hire assimilation. The successful candidate will handle ongoing recruiting and staffing needs of the organization, as well as execute long term, strategic activities in support of the future talent needs of Gorbel.
Specific Duties:
  • Develop and execute recruiting processes to creatively source, identify, screen and interview candidates to present to internal management for open job requisitions.
  • Works closely with hiring managers to understand service expectations, position responsibilities and needs, required timelines, and organization dynamics to ensure candidates are well matched with the company and job.
  • Makes hiring recommendations and influences hiring decisions in the best interest of the organization.
  • Maintains records related to recruitment and selection activities and processes.
  • Perform other related duties and various special projects as required and assigned
  • Develops and utilizes appropriate candidate assessment tools and techniques and ensures that all selection practices adhere to state and federal requirements, and support the strategy and values of Gorbel.
  • Identify potential key staffing sources/partners such as universities, trade schools, placement agencies, social media outlets, etc. that have the potential to ensure Gorbel’s success at attracting a diverse and talented employee population. Assesses potential partners to determine best strategic fit with Gorbel, and develop long term, ongoing partnerships with those that best meet the needs of Gorbel.
  • Identify opportunities for long term talent “feeder streams” (such as local STEM programs) and develop strategies and relationships that provide a long term (five or more years out) pipeline of talent for key positions. These activities may be Gorbel only initiatives, or may occur in collaboration with other employers or business partners.
  • Develop rapid, flexible, compliant pre-qualification and onboarding processes that reduce administration, speed time to fill, and can be applied in an environment where new hires may be on a multitude of shifts and/or may be remotely located.
  • Monitor and report on quantitative turnover trends and data
  • Work with Marketing group to create and execute a social media strategy that supports our employment brand and raises the “profile” of Gorbel as an employer in the community, industry, and beyond.
  • Partner with operations leadership to develop flexible hourly staffing strategy that supports business fluctuations, and execute strategy.
  • Develop ready “talent pool” of fully screened and qualified candidates for key jobs. Develop and execute practices to ensure that candidates in this pool remain aware of and interested in Gorbel.
  • Owns overall responsibility for the Gorbel new employee assimilation process. Works with other Gorbel team members to develop robust onboarding practices. Personally executes some activities in the process.
  • Develop and report on relevant staffing metrics such as time to fill, source analysis, quality of hire, and turnover analysis. Utilize historical data analysis to identify opportunities for improvement and execute job responsibilities to achieve agreed upon targets.
